Output 3dbc7795c8f5b817f42d1e717e0f939ace6d3f169766f7554eceac3030708a1a:0

value
58023380
script pubkey
OP_0 OP_PUSHBYTES_20 5b621292722fa3947adb16fa9d2deef7214e1eea
address
ltc1qtd3p9ynj973eg7kmzmaf6t0w7us5u8h2gllf5s
transaction
3dbc7795c8f5b817f42d1e717e0f939ace6d3f169766f7554eceac3030708a1a
spent
true